Interfaith Tour—Light, Darkness, Nature, and Peace
Guided interfaith tours through the Saint Louis Art Museum’s galleries will focus on the themes of light, darkness, nature, and peace. Tours depart from Sculpture Hall. Space is limited, and spots will be filled on a first-come, first-served basis. The tour will be available at 3 pm and 7 pm.
In collaboration with Arts & Faith St. Louis, the Museum is offering a day of programming called Finding Peace in Current Times. In addition to the tours, the daylong event will include film screenings and a live youth performance that includes spoken word, music, and dance.
